This D3000 (later 08) class shunter had chosen a particularly inconvenient place to come of the rails, on one of the main exit tracks from this very important loco shed. Note the number of onlookers, more interested in the fact that they were being photographed than in putting the situation to rights! Kingmoor sheds closed in 1968, the deserted area quickly succumbing to natural overgrowth which has since become a nature reserve https://www.geograph.org.uk/photo/4610991
